Why does the marginal rate of substitution diminish?

As a matter of fact, law of diminishing marginal rate of substitution conforms to the law of diminishing marginal utility. According to law of diminishing marginal utility, as a consumer increases the consumption of a good, its marginal utility goes on diminishing. On the contrary, if the consumption of a good decreases, its marginal utility goes on increasing.

What does the law of marginal diminishing utility say?

That the more times one uses an object or item, the less enjoyment (utility) he/she gets out of it. For example if you were to eat pizza every night, the marginal law of diminishing utility says that you would slowly lose enjoyment from it and would most likely be sick of it pretty soon
